Shopify, Prestashop, WooCommerce : que faire quand votre boutique en ligne ralentit, bug ou plante soudainement ?

shopify

Votre boutique en ligne rame, elle affiche des erreurs étranges ou devient totalement inaccessible, cela peut coûter des centaines d’euros de chiffre d’affaires par heure. Que vous soyez sur Shopify, PrestaShop ou WooCommerce, ces situations critiques ne préviennent pas même si, certaines alarmes clignotent tout de même avant la panne. Ces situations peuvent survenir après l’installation d’un plugin, une surcharge de trafic, une attaque, ou une simple mise à jour mal passée.
Notre centre de compétences va tenter de vous guider afin de diagnostiquer, comprendre et corriger rapidement ce type de problème. Un guide utile à garder sous la main ou à transmettre à un expert quand l’urgence devient trop complexe.

1. Les symptômes fréquents d’un site e-commerce instable

Sous Shopify cela peut se matérialiser par :
– Des pages qui mettent plusieurs secondes à charger
– Des erreurs 500 ou pages blanches
– Des problèmes sur mobile (boutons inactifs, chargement infini)
– Une admin qui devient très lente ou inaccessible

Sous PrestaShop voici quelques signes cliniques :
– Un back-office bloqué (erreur 504, 500, ou “timeout”)
– Des ajouts au panier impossibles
– Le CSS ou JavaScript qui ne se chargent plus
– Des problèmes après mise à jour d’un module

Sous WooCommerce vous pouvez rencontrer :
– Le WordPress Dashboard inaccessible
– Des erreurs PHP visibles sur le front
– Des paiements qui ne passent plus
– Un plugin qui casse l’apparence du thème

Ces dysfonctionnements sur votre site e-commerce peuvent avoir des causes très différentes. Pour agir efficacement, il faut un diagnostic structuré de ces symptômes. Pour vous aider, vous pouvez suivre les recommandations suivantes :

2. Quelles sont les causes les plus fréquentes ?

a) Une extension ou application défectueuse
Pour Shopify cela peut être une App mal codée ou en conflit avec une autre.
Pour PrestaShop, un module obsolète ou non compatible avec votre version.
Pour WooCommerce, il s’agit peut-être d’un plugin WordPress mal développé ou en conflit
b) Un thème trop lourd ou mal optimisé
En effet, votre site Shopify beug ? Dans certains cas un thème premium ou sur mesure contenant trop de scripts, un CSS et JS non compressés ou encore des images non optimisées peuvent affaiblir votre site et créer de nombreuses erreurs et dysfonctionnements.
c) Une attaque ou injection de code
Un incident malveillant peut être la cause de vos problèmes et engendrera un nettoyage malware de Shopify, les raisons : un malware dans le thème ou une extension, des redirections vers des sites externes, des scripts inconnus détectés dans le code source…
d) Une mise à jour qui s’est mal passée
Dans le cadre d’une migration de version mal gérée (surtout sur PrestaShop et Woo Commerce) ou encore qui n’a pas aboutie, vous rencontrerez des problèmes de ce type. Les mises à jour et migrations sont deux actions distinctes qui nécessites parfois des compétences pour qu’elles se déroulent sans accrochages. Mêmes les mises à jour ne se valent pas de l’une à l’autre et peuvent vous donner du fil à retordre.
Dans cette situation, nous vous conseillerons toujours de faire appel à des experts sur les CMS WordPress, Prestashop et Shopify surtout dans le cadre de migrations qui, 8 fois sur 10 posent problèmes. Vous pouvez joindre des experts sur les 3 CMS au 09 54 43 67 20, tous les jours ouvrés.
Vous pouvez également rencontrer des problèmes de compatibilité entre les différents éléments du site.
e) Une surcharge de trafic ou un problème serveur
Votre boutique e-commerce est lente possiblement à cause d’un hébergement mutualisé qui limite les ressources, d’une panne temporaire chez l’hébergeur, d’un CDN ou cache mal configuré.
f) Comment diagnostiquer le problème rapidement
Voici une méthode applicable quel que soit votre CMS : (Étapes de base pour tous)
– Tester la vitesse avec PageSpeed Insights ou GTmetrix ,
– Vérifier la console navigateur (clic droit > inspecter > console) pour repérer les erreurs JS ;
– Désactiver temporairement les dernières apps et plugins installés ;
– Changer temporairement de thème (Shopify : thème de base PrestaShop/WooCommerce : thème par défaut).
Spécificité sur Shopify : ex de message d’erreur : problème Shopify Checkout
– Utiliser le Shopify Theme Inspector (plugin Chrome)
– Analyser le fichier theme.liquid
– Vérifier les logs dans l’admin Shopify > Paramètres > Notifications
Spécifique sur PrestaShop : ex : Erreur 500 Prestashop
– Activer le mode debug (defines.inc.php)
– Vérifier les erreurs dans /log ou via le module « Performance »
– Désactiver les overrides et les modules non natifs
Spécifique sur WooCommerce : ex : WordPress WooCommerce crash
– Activer WP_DEBUG dans le fichier wp-config.php
– Utiliser « Query Monitor » pour analyser les erreurs PHP et SQL
– Tester le site en mode sans échec avec l’extension « Health Check & Troubleshooting »

3. Que pouvez-vous faire vous-même (et quand faire appel à un professionnel) ?

a) Ce que vous pouvez d’ores et déjà tenter en cas de Plugin WooCommerce instable, App Shopify qui ralentit le site, un malware sur Prestashop… :
– Désactiver temporairement les éléments suspects,
– Rétablir une version précédente stable (via backup ou Git si disponible) ;
– Supprimer les scripts ajoutés manuellement récemment ;
– Scanner le site avec un outil de sécurité (Sucuri Check, Virusdie, Virus Total…).

b) Quand contacter un expert :
– Lorsque vous ne trouvez pas l’origine du problème malgré vos tests.
– Si vous avez détecté du code malveillant.
– Si le site reste indisponible après restauration.
– Dans le cas où vous avez besoin de sécuriser la boutique pour éviter une rechute.
– Pour un nettoyage post-attaque car cela demande de grandes compétences pour nettoyer et sécuriser le site pour éviter que votre site conserve des failles de sécurité. Nous conseillons après attaque sur un site de vous rapprocher d’un centre de compétences pour un contrat annuel de maintenance évitant ainsi qu’une autre attaque ne puisse sévir.
– Pour une optimisation de performance et de vitesse, préférez faire appel à des spécialistes.
– Lors d’une correction de bugs liés aux thèmes ou modules.
– Pour assurer, comme dit précédemment, la maintenance continue avec alerte automatique.
– Si vous souhaitez effectuer une refonte technique légère ou complète.

c) Comment éviter que cela ne se reproduise
– Le conseil le plus évident est de faire des sauvegardes régulières (et de les tester !), ce n’est pas qu’un détail, c’est primordial.
– Evitez d’installer trop d’extensions non vérifiées.
– Tenir votre CMS et vos plugins à jour.
– Mettre en place une surveillance de performance automatisée.
– Utiliser des environnements de test avant toute mise en production

4. Besoin d’un audit express de votre boutique ?

Que vous utilisiez Shopify, Prestashop ou WooCommerce, notre centre de compétences est disponible pour :
– Diagnostiquer gratuitement les problèmes urgents,
– Intervenir rapidement sur des bugs, ralentissements ou erreurs critiques ;
– Mettre en place des plans de maintenance ou de refonte adaptés à votre CMS

Vous pouvez contacter nos experts au 09 54 43 67 20 pour tous besoins.

Shopify, PrestaShop, WooCommerce : tous les CMS ont leurs points forts et leurs zones de fragilité. Ce qui fait la différence, c’est votre capacité à réagir vite ou à vous entourer des bons partenaires techniques.
Vous ne pouvez pas laisser un bug technique ou une attaque compromettre votre activité. Support-Presta.com est là pour vous aider à reprendre le contrôle de votre boutique en ligne.

Vous souhaitez plus d'informations ?